The REALITY is that the risks to our drinking water from gas drilling go well beyond fracking

Spills, work site accidents, truck accidents and illegal activity can and do happen in every industry

With gas drilling, though, we're dealing with millions of gallons of dangerous and deadly chemicals, thousands of gas wells and millions of truck trips

Despite the best effort of industry, these events did occur

Disasters big and small will continue to occur and continue to put your drinking water at risk
